Abstract

To analyze the ground vibration caused by blasting demolition of urban overpass, in this paper we introduced the measurement method and then studied the characteristics of recorded ground vibrations. Through analysis of peak acceleration, peak frequency and duration, results indicate that, the vertical component of vibration is the most important in the region close to the collapse point; the collapse of bridge segments will lead to superposition of ground vibration, and isolation measures can reduce the peak acceleration but increase the duration of vibration; blasting and collapse vibration cause no damage to the reserved structure which indicates that blasting description is a safe and effective method.
